Description Olav V (Alexander Edward Christian Frederik; 2 July 1903 – 17 January 1991) was the King of Norway from 1957 until his death. This is a drawing from his childhood that appeared in a contemporary US newspaper. Original caption: Returning greetings in England from car window.
